WebCharge the lithium battery every 3 months (keep SOC over 50%) at shelf time. Avoid leaving your battery fully discharged for long periods of time. It’s best to keep it at least 30% charged. However, do not charge or discharge your battery more than necessary. Try to keep the number of full charges and discharges at a minimum. WebAs the cycle time gets longer, self-discharge comes into play and CE drops (gets worse). Electrolyte oxidation at the cathode, in part, causes this self-discharge. Li-ion loses about 2 percent per month at 0ºC (32ºF) with a state-of-charge of 50 percent and up to 35 percent at 60ºC (140ºF) when fully charged. Table 1 provides data for the ...
